General Description

3-Ethoxy-4-hydroxybenzonitrile is a chemical compound with the molecular formula C9H9NO2. It is a white solid at room temperature, and it is commonly used in the pharmaceutical industry as an intermediate for the synthesis of various drugs and pharmaceutical products. 3-ETHOXY-4-HYDROXYBENZONITRILE is known for its aromatic and hydroxyl properties, as well as its nitrile group, which makes it suitable for use in drug development. Additionally, 3-ethoxy-4-hydroxybenzonitrile is also used in organic synthesis and research, where its unique chemical structure and properties make it a valuable and versatile compound for various applications.

Check Digit Verification of cas no

The CAS Registry Mumber 60758-79-4 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,0,7,5 and 8 respectively; the second part has 2 digits, 7 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 60758-79:
(7*6)+(6*0)+(5*7)+(4*5)+(3*8)+(2*7)+(1*9)=144
144 % 10 = 4
So 60758-79-4 is a valid CAS Registry Number.

Solvent free, microwave assisted conversion of aldehydes into nitriles and oximes in the presence of NH2OH · HCl and TiO2

Hoelz, Lucas Villas-Boas,Goncalves, Biank Tomaz,Barros, Jose Celestino,Silva, Joaquim Fernando Mendes Da

experimental part, p. 94 - 99 (2010/05/18)

Aromatic aldehydes bearing electron-donating groups are easily converted into their respective nitriles using NH2OH · HCl and TiO 2 under microwave irradiation, while those bearing an electron-withdrawing group give the corresponding oximes.
